Abstract
There are two problems in video communication, one is related to heterogeneity of networks, and the other involves reliability of transmission. Layered coding is designed to solve client heterogeneity problems, and multiple description coding is an effective method for robust transmission. Multiple description layered coding (MDLC) of video combines advantages of layered coding and multiple description coding. In this paper, a new MDLC scheme of video sequence is proposed based on macroblock splitting technique. In addition, other three schemes of MDLC are also given based on row-, column-, and framedecomposition. Experimental results show that the proposed MDLC scheme with macroblock splitting (MDLC-MS) has advantages in adaptability of network heterogeneity and transmission reliability.
